Where to Find a Spare Key Maker Near Me

A spare key can help prevent an unpleasant day from getting worse. There are plenty of places where keys can be easily and quickly. These include hardware stores, auto parts stores and grocery stores.

The majority of locations have a kiosk that can create standard brass and house keys, as well as older car keys with no key fobs. Some locations also provide locksmith services to create special keys.

Advance Auto Parts

If you have lost your car key, you can easily get it duplicated at any of the numerous auto parts stores that operate in America. The majority of modern vehicles use keys with embedded transponders that need to be programmed new in order to work properly. It's essential to have a spare car key on hand.

There are plenty of places that offer this service, such as Advance Auto Parts and O'Reilly Auto Parts. There aren't all stores that can create all kinds of keys. It is best to contact your local store to inquire about what they can do before you visit. Auto Parts Stores

You can get keys made at auto parts stores. They sell a variety of key blanks in various sizes and can duplicate various kinds of car keys including key fobs. Some locations do not provide this service. Contact us to confirm prior to visiting your local store.

KeyMe kiosks are available at certain AutoZone stores. They can easily and quickly duplicate all keys, including those for vehicles office buildings, homes, and more. They can also reprogram a large number of key fobs.

Other stores in the automotive industry like NAPA, also provide various key-making services. They can cut or program and duplicate most keys for cars including key fobs. Ace Hardware

Ace Hardware is one of the most popular places to buy gardening supplies, household tools, and home décor. According to the website, customers can also discover useful features like garage door openers and mail boxes.

Ace Hardware stores offer in-store key cutting for standard keys for offices, house keys and more. Some have KeyMe self-service kiosks that can copy fobs and keys for cars and fobs, too. Contact the store to find out whether they have these services.

A key duplication machine uses the original template as a reference to cut into the blank key. This creates the new key and makes it smooth so that it is ready to use. Shoppers can choose from barrel blanks made of metal with an opening at the tip or bit blanks that are reminiscent of skeleton keys. Keys come in a variety colours and finishes.
